Primecap Management Co. CA trimmed its stake in shares of CrowdStrike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:CRWD - Free Report) by 4.5%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 130,436 shares of the company's stock after selling 6,100 shares during the period. Primecap Management Co. CA owned about 0.05% of CrowdStrike worth $44,630,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

About CrowdStrike

(Free Report)

CrowdStrike Holdings, Inc provides cybersecurity solutions in the United States and internationally. Its unified platform offers cloud-delivered protection of endpoints, cloud workloads, identity, and data. The company offers corporate endpoint and cloud workload security, managed security, security and vulnerability management, IT operations management, identity protection, SIEM and log management, threat intelligence, data protection, security orchestration, automation and response and AI powered workflow automation, and securing generative AI workload services.
